Adipic Acid Dihydrazide
CAS Number: 1071-93-8
Empirical Formula: C6H14N4O2
Adipic Acid Dihydrazide (ADH) is a difunctional crosslinking agent used to cure functionalized copolymers, such as those containing aldehyde, ketone, and epoxy moieties. At room temperature, the amino functionality of ADH rapidly crosslinks copolymers containing diacetone acrylamide (DAAM). ADH is also used as a curing agent for bisphenol glycidyl epoxy resins, and for urethane pre-polymers. ADH has been used to scavenge formaldehyde.

ADH is moderately soluble in water. It is an effective curative in aqueous emulsions and dispersions.
